KUHL  Frost Soft-Shell Pants - Women's 32" Inseam

Don't let snow, sleet and ice slow you down. The women's KUHL Frost soft-shell pants feature a technical soft-shell fabric bonded to a microfiber fleece backer for superior warmth and comfort.

Shop newer version

Features

  • Wide elastic waistband provides a comfortable fit; rib-knit inner waistband wicks away moisture; snap and fly front closure
  • Zippered front hand pockets secure valuables; jeans-style back pockets
  • 15.5 in. bottom hem opening; bottom hem gusset zips open to fit over winter boots

Technical Specs

Best Use

Multisport

Fabric

86% polyester/14% spandex

Lining Fabric

89% polyester/11% spandex

Pants Rise

Mid

Pant Fit

Standard

Pant Leg Style

Straight

Inseam (in.)

32 inches

Gender

Women's

Weight

1 lb. 1.6 oz.

Elizabeth
Location:San Francisco, CA
Rated 3.0 out of 5 stars
5 years ago

Stud snap didn’t stay closed.

The pants are warm and comfortable. I used them for a week in Yellowstone during the holidays. I agree that they run a bit small. I often wear a size 4 but got a size 6 to accommodate long underwear. I liked the 32” length as I have long legs and pants are often too short. Unfortunately, the stud snap on the waistband popped open every time I bent over, such as to tie my shoe. I’m not sure if it was defective or just didn’t work well. When I returned them, there weren’t any in the store to compare mine to.

WaterKat
Rated 4.0 out of 5 stars
5 years ago

Attractive, comfortable but size up!

These are typicall high quality comfortable Kuhl pants. I love cool because they make clothing for women with real bodies. These pants had every feature I was looking for, wind and water resistant, lined, zip pockets, zip lower legs for easy on/off over hiking boots. Sadly, they definitely run small especially for active use. Highly recommend going up one size for a good fit with these. I have to return mine.

Rhonda
Weight:100–125 lbs.
Height:5'3"
Rated 5.0 out of 5 stars
4 years ago

Perfect for winter activities

I bought these for XC skiing and they are just what I was looking for! Room for layers under but being fleece lined didn’t need for temps in the teens and 20s. Very comfortable and not bulky. Zippers at the bottom work well for going over boots and keeping snow out. I was worried these would be too long, but in the end glad I opted not to get the ‘short’ version since these were perfect length with boots.
